Takashi Sanae plans to reduce Japan's food consumption tax to 1% for a period of two years
2026-07-30 17:38:07
According to CoinMeta, Japanese Prime Minister Sanae Toshihiro announced on the 30th that starting from next April, the consumption tax on food will be reduced from 8% to 1% for a period of two years. At the same time, cash subsidies equivalent to the amount of the 1% consumption tax will be distributed to low- and middle-income groups. This is a large-scale tax reduction measure introduced by Toshihiro Toshihiro's cabinet to address the continuous rise in prices, and it is expected that the plan will be approved by the cabinet at the beginning of August. However, the plan faces challenges regarding the source of fiscal funds, which amount to about 5 trillion yen per year, as well as political pressure to revert to the original tax rate after two years. The Japanese government hopes to boost consumer confidence, which has been sluggish due to high prices, by lowering the consumption tax. According to an analysis by Nikkei News, if the consumption tax on food is reduced to 1%, Japan's CPI is expected to decline by 1 to 1.4 percentage points in the fiscal year 2027. Nevertheless, the market generally expects that the actual benefits for consumers from this tax reduction may be lower than anticipated. The head of the Economic Research Department at the Japan Life Foundation Institute stated that companies may use the tax reduction to absorb rising costs and not fully reflect the tax cut in product prices, so the actual price reduction is likely to be smaller.
